Summary:Anisakis physeteris (Baylis, 1923) Host: Physeter macrocephalus Linnaeus Site in host: stomach Locality: Puerto Madryn (43º14'S, 65º02'W), Chubut province Specimens in collections: MML (accession numbers not provided)V References: Berón-Vera et al. (2008) 2. Information on the developmental stage of the acanthocephalans is not provided in the published record. Anisakis simplex (Rudolphi, 1809) s.l. 3 Host: Delphinus delphis Linnaeus Site in host: forestomach Locality: northern Patagonia (39º–42ºS, 60º–62ºW) Specimens in collections: USNPC (99622)V References: Berón-Vera et al. (2007) Host: Lagenorhynchus cruciger (Quoy & Gaimard) Site in host: stomach Locality: Playa Unión (43º20'S, 65º00'W), Rawson, and Playa Paraná (42º49'S, 64º53'W), Puerto Madryn, Chubut province References: Fernández et al. (2003) Host: Lagenorhynchus obscurus (Gray) Site in host: forestomach, main stomach Locality: Claromecó (38º52'S, 60º05'W) and Necochea (38º27'S, 58º50'W), Buenos Aires province Specimens in collections: BMNH ... : Published as part of Hernández-Orts, Jesús S., Viola, M.
